Day 2 Fri: Istanbul (B)
-
Enjoy a full-day tour including a visit to Topkapi Palace Museum, the residence of the Ottoman Sultans between 1453–1852 (excluding Harem).
-
Visit the Hippodrome, once the center of life where chariot racing and other public events took place.
-
Tour the Blue Mosque, built between 1609 and 1616, famous for its blue ceramic tiles.
-
An optional visit to St. Sophia, a church built in the 6th century Byzantine capital, converted to a mosque by the Ottomans, still functioning as a mosque today and one of the world’s greatest architectural wonders.
-
Your last stop is the Grand Bazaar.

Day 5 Mon: Ephesus & St. Mary’s House – Izmir (B)
-
Tour the famous ruins of Ephesus, an important cultural center of the ancient world, and explore 2,000-year-old marble streets, a theater, the Library of Celsius, a gymnasium, and Hadrian’s Temple.
-
Take a short drive to see St. Mary’s stone cottage where it is believed Virgin Mary spent her last years accompanied by St. John.
